Safeguarding Australia's Military Secrets

The Australian government passed the Defence Amendment , which will be enforced from 7 August 2024. The legislation requires certain Australian citizens and permanent residents to have a Foreign Work Authorisation (FWA) when working for or providing military-related training to a foreign military or foreign government body (including foreign public universities). Individuals have a personal obligation to obtain the FWA.
